How to Write a CV That Gets You Hired in 2026

Job seeker writing a CV on a laptop following CV tips 2026

A strong CV in 2026 is one or two pages long, opens with a short profile that matches the job, lists skills before qualifications, and uses specific results rather than duties. Temp to Perm Explained: How It Works for Employers and Job Seekers

Temp to perm worker starting a permanent role in a UK warehouse office

Temp to perm is a hiring arrangement where a worker starts on a temporary contract through a staffing agency and, after an agreed trial period, moves into a permanent role with the employer. Hiring Trends 2026: What Employers and Job Seekers Need to Know

Recruiter and candidate discussing hiring trends 2026 in a UK office

The five biggest hiring trends in 2026 are replacement hiring over growth hiring, higher applicant volumes with tougher screening, skills-based hiring replacing credential requirements, salary overtaking flexibility as the top offer factor, and mobile-first, low-friction application processes.
